Abstract

Penyebaran African Swine Fever Virus (ASFV) di Indonesia terus berlanjut sampai saat ini, ASF merupakan penyakit infeksius yang menyerang babi dengan mortalitas yang tinggi. Deteksi ASF secara cepat dan efektif sangat dibutuhkan untuk perdagangan internasional maupun lokal agar dapat mencegah penyebaran virus. Tujuan dari penelitian ini adalah untuk mengetahui imunogenesitas protein rekombinan CD2v dengan berat molekul 45 kDa yang dikloning dan diekspresikan pada media kultur sel bakteri E.coli BL21 bersifat imunogenik deteksi dini penyakit ASF. Sampel protein rekombinan CD2v 45 kDa yang digunakan berasal dari PUSVETMA Surabaya. Kemudian dilakukan pemurnian protein target melalui metode elektroelusi gel hasil teknik elektroforesis SDS-PAGE berdasarkan berat molekul 45 kDa. Imunisasi awal dan booster pada kelinci jantan New Zealand (Oryctolagus cuniculus) menggunakan hasil elusi protein rekombinan CD2v diberikan secara subkutan dengan dosis 800µL dengan penambahan adjuvant CFA (Complete Freund’s Adjuvant) dan IFA (Incomplate Freund’s Adjuvant). Uji imunogenisitas protein CD2v menggunakan metode indirect ELISA dan Western blotting. Hasil uji indirect ELISA menunjukkan nilai titer antibodi tertinggi pada pengambian darah terakhir dengan nilai 0,534. Pada uji Western blotting menunjukkan bahwa antibodi antiCD2v dapat mengenali antigen CD2v pada berat molekul 45 kDa.

English Abstract

The spread of African Swine Fever Virus (ASFV) in Indonesia continues to increase until this day. ASF is an infectious disease that attacks pigs with high mortality rate. Fast and effective detection of ASF is needed to prevent the spread of the virus in international and local market trade. The aim of this study was to determine the immunogenicity of the recombinant CD2v protein with a molecular weight of 45 kDa which was cloned and expressed in bacterial cell culture media of E. coli BL21 which is immunogenic for early detection of ASF disease. The recombinant protein sample of CD2v 45 kDa used was obtained from PUSVETMA Surabaya. The target protein then purified using the gel electroelution method of the SDS-PAGE electrophoresis technique based on a molecular weight of 45 kDa. Initial and booster immunization in New Zealand male rabbits (Oryctolagus cuniculus) using the elution of recombinant CD2v protein was administered subcutaneously at a dose of 800µL with the addition of CFA (Complete Freund's Adjuvant) and IFA (Incomplate Freund's Adjuvant) adjuvants. Indirect ELISA and Western blotting methods was used to test the CD2v protein immunogenicity. The results of the indirect ELISA test showed the highest antibody titer value is in the last bleeding with a value of 0.534. The Western blotting test showed that the anti-CD2v antibody could recognize the CD2v antigen at a molecular weight of 45 kDa.
